Before 2008, the term ‘Challenger Bank’ didn’t form part of anybody’s vocabulary. What Do You Need To Open Tide Bank Account… The business banking industry was controlled by the ‘huge four’ High Street banks of HSBC, Barclays, NatWest, and Lloyds Banking Group and this had held true for several years. Then came the international financial crash of 2008 and everything changed.

With, the charge is , 2.50 for deposits approximately , 500 or 0.5% of the cash amount for deposits over , 500. This fee is , 3 for up to , 1000 with Starling. If you wish to deposit more than , 1000 at a Post Office with Starling, then this will attract a fee of 0.3% of the total amount being deposited. After investing , 500 billion on a rescue plan to help stabilise the UK banking system and bring back market confidence, both regulators and the government were anxious to put procedures in place to prevent such a crisis from ever occurring again. A crucial part of this technique was to encourage more competitors in the banking sector to lower the supremacy of the big banks in the market. With the levelling of the playing field, chances were also opened up for entrepreneurs to bring a digital transformation to the banking space. Not only did this bring growth in brand-new innovation, but a relocation far from the standard High Street banking design, and the birth of the Challenger Banks.

The company initially formed in 2015 as a fintech endeavor and has actually given that grown from strength to strength. At the start of 2019, they secured , 60 million of moneying to broaden their offering when they partnered with ClearBank.
